Corryong Health operates as a Multipurpose Service (MPS), a flexible health care model designed to provide integrated health and aged care services in rural and remote areas.
Corryong Health serves as a key healthcare provider for the Upper Murray region, ensuring access to essential services. We constantly work towards building a service profile that reflects the entire community, to ensure people feel cared for, have an opportunity to be healthy, live well and are connected across the healthcare ecosystem. As the community population profile changes, so too does the Corryong Health service mix.
